search

計算機二級基礎知識

計算機二級基礎知識

  1、基本資料結構與演算法:演算法的基本概念;演算法複雜度的概念和意義(時間複雜度與空間複雜度)。資料結構的定義;資料的邏輯結構與儲存結構;資料結構的圖形表示;線性結構與非線性結構的概念。

  2、線性表的定義:線性表的順序儲存結構及其插入與刪除運算。棧和佇列的定義;棧和佇列的順序儲存結構及其基本運算。線性單鏈表、雙向連結串列與迴圈連結串列的結構及其基本運算。

  3、樹的基本概念:二叉樹的定義及其儲存結構;二叉樹的前序、中序和後序遍歷。順序查詢與二分法查詢演算法;基本排序演算法(交換類排序,選擇類排序,插入類排序)。

  4、程式設計基礎:程式設計方法與風格。結構化程式設計。面向物件的程式設計方法,物件,方法,屬性及繼承與多型性。

  5、軟體工程基礎:軟體工程基本概念,軟體生命週期概念,軟體工具與軟體開發環境。結構化分析方法,資料流圖,資料字典,軟體需求規格說明書。結構化設計方法,總體設計與詳細設計。

  6、軟體測試的方法:白盒測試與黑盒測試,測試用例設計,軟體測試的實施,單元測試、整合測試和系統測試。程式的除錯,靜態除錯與報考除錯。

  7、資料庫設計基礎:資料庫的基本概念:資料庫,資料庫管理系統,資料庫系統。資料模型,實體聯絡模型及 E-R 圖,從 E-R 圖匯出關係資料模型。

  8、關係代數運算:包括集合運算及選擇、投影、連線運算,資料庫規範化理論。資料庫設計方法和步驟:需求分析、概念設計、邏輯設計和物理設計的相關策略。

計算機原理基礎知識

  計算機原理由馮・諾依曼(VonNeumann)與莫爾小組於1943年至1946年提出,在人類科技史上還沒有一種科學可以與計算機的發展之快相提並論。計算機原理適用於科學計算、資訊管理等領域。計算機系統包含硬體系統和軟體系統,硬體系統是計算機的基礎,軟體系統是計算機的上層建築。一個完整的計算機系統必須包含硬體系統和軟體系統,只有硬體系統沒有軟體系統的機器叫裸機。

計算機網路基礎知識有什麼

  1、計算機網路基礎:對“計算機網路”這個概念的理解和定義,隨著計算機網路本身的發展,人們提出了各種不同的觀點。

  早期的計算機系統是高度集中的,所有的裝置安裝在單獨的大房間中,後來出現了批處理和分時系統,分時系統所連線的多個終端必須緊接著主計算機。50年代中後期,許多系統都將地理上分散的多個終端透過通訊線路連線到一臺中心計算機上,這樣就出現了第一代計算機網路。

  2、第一代計算機網路是以單個計算機為中心的遠端聯機系統。典型應用是由一臺計算機和全美範圍內2000多個終端組成的飛機定票系統。終端:一臺計算機的外部裝置包括CRT控制器和鍵盤,無GPU記憶體。隨著遠端終端的增多,在主機前增加了前端機FEP當時,人們把計算機網路定義為“以傳輸資訊為目的而連線起來,實現遠端資訊處理或近一步達到資源共享的系統”,但這樣的通訊系統己具備了通訊的雛形。

  3、第二代計算機網路是以多個主機透過通訊線路互聯起來,為使用者提供服務,興起於60年代後期,典型代表是美國國防部高階研究計劃局協助開發的ARPAnet。主機之間不是直接用線路相連,而是介面報文處理機IMP轉接後互聯的。IMP和它們之間互聯的通訊線路一起負責主機間的通訊任務,構成了通訊子網。通訊子網互聯的主機負責執行程式,提供資源共享,組成了資源子網。兩個主機間通訊時對傳送資訊內容的理解,資訊表示形式以及各種情況下的應答訊號都必須遵守一個共同的約定,稱為協議。

  4、在ARPA網中,將協議按功能分成了若干層次,如何分層,以及各層中具體採用的協議的總和,稱為網路體系結構,體系結構是個抽象的概念,其具體實現是透過特定的硬體和軟體來完成的。70年代至80年代中第二代網路得到迅猛的發展。第二代網路以通訊子網為中心。這個時期,網路概念為“以能夠相互共享資源為目的互聯起來的具有獨立功能的計算機之集合體”,形成了計算機網路的基本概念。第三代計算機網路是具有統一的網路體系結構並遵循國際標準的開放式和標準化的網路。

  5、IS0在1984年頒佈了0SI/RM,該模型分為七個層次,也稱為0SI七層模型,公認為新一代計算機網路體系結構的基礎。為普及區域網奠定了基礎。(^60090922a^1)70年代後,由於大規模積體電路出現,區域網由於投資少,方便靈活而得到了廣泛的應用和迅猛的發展,與廣域網相比有共性,如分層的體系結構,又有不同的特性,如區域網為節省費用而不採用儲存轉發的方式,而是由單個的廣播通道來連結網上計算機。

  6、第四代計算機網路從80年代末開始,區域網技術發展成熟,出現光纖及高速網路技術,多媒體,智慧網路,整個網路就像一個對使用者透明的大的計算機系統,發展為以Internet為代表的網際網路。計算機網路:將多個具有獨立工作能力的計算機系統透過通訊裝置和線路由功能完善的網路軟體實現資源共享和資料通訊的系統。

  7、從定義中看出涉及到三個方面的問題:至少兩臺計算機互聯。

  通訊裝置與線路介質。網路軟體,通訊協議和NOS


計算機二級公共基礎知識是什麼啊

  計算機二級公共基礎知識是計算機中綜合性知識,包含的科目有資料結構,軟體工程,演算法設計與分析,資料庫設計等。這些科目都屬於計算機專業必修課,也是一個程式設計師的必備理論基礎。   計算機二級公共基礎知識考試大綱基本要求:   1、掌握演算法的基本概念。   2、掌握基本資料結構及其操作。   3、掌握基本 ...

計算機基礎知識學習

  1、面向連線服務具有連線建立、資料傳輸和連線釋放這三個階段。面向連線服務是在資料交換之前,必須先建立連線。當資料交換結束後,則必須終止這個連線。在傳送資料時是按序傳送的,是可靠交付。面向連線服務比較適合於在一定期間內要向同一目的地傳送許多報文的情況。   2、點對點協議工作在鏈路層,通常用在兩節點之問建立 ...

計算機基礎知識與操作有哪些

  本書內容主要包括計算機基礎知識、Windows作業系統、網路知識與操作、文字處理軟體Word、電子表格Excel、簡報PowerPoint、多媒體與常用工具軟體等。為了及時鞏固所學知識,本書增加了上機操作指導和操作練習等內容,並在每章都配有相應的練習題。 ...

計算機基礎知識

  1、計算機安全是指計算機資產安全,即(計算機資訊系統和資訊不受自然和人為有害因素威脅和危害)。   2、度量計算機運算速度常用的單位是( MIPS)。   3、下列裝置組中,完全屬於計算機輸出裝置的一組是( 印表機,繪圖儀,顯示器)。   4、世界上公認的第一臺電子計算機誕生的年代是( 20世紀40年代) ...

計算機基礎知識包括什麼

  計算機的一些常識,如基本構成:運算器、控制器、儲存器、計算機的所有輸入或輸出裝置 、DOS知識 、電子計算機的發展和用途 、 電子計算機系統的組成和工作原理 、計算機的維護 、中文Windows作業系統、中文Word的使用、中文Excel的使用、計算機網路基礎知識及上機指導 、計算機網路與安全基礎知識。 ...

計算機網路技術基礎知識

  計算機網路技術基礎知識是高職高專和本科院校計算機網路技術專業、計算機應用專業、軟體工程專業、電子商務專業等計算機相關專業所開設的一門專業技術基礎課。主要介紹計算機網路的基礎知識,從計算機網路的基本概念入手,介紹基本通訊理論、計算機網路的體系結構、Internet與TCP/IP、區域網的概念及組成、網路設計 ...

計算機基礎知識考試

  計算機基礎知識考試的目的是面向社會、服務於社會。透過考核可以瞭解高校非計算機專業學生對計算機、網路以及其他相關資訊科技的基本知識和基本技能的掌握情況,促進學生提高計算機素質和計算機應用能力,同時可以為就業市場提供學生計算機應用知識與能力水平證明,便於用人單位有一個統一、客觀、公正的標準,從而促進計算機知識 ...